Exploring the vibrant world of batik, a traditional Indonesian fabric art, reveals its potential to enhance artistic appreciation among the younger generation. This age-old craft involves using wax to draw intricate patterns on fabric, which is then dyed to create colorful designs. Despite its historical significance and cultural richness, batik often struggles to capture the interest of today's youth, who are more inclined towards modern and digital forms of entertainment. However, by integrating batik into educational curriculums and promoting it through contemporary mediums, there is a promising opportunity to rekindle interest and respect for this traditional art form among young people.

The Educational Value of Batik

Introducing batik in schools as part of the art curriculum can serve as an effective method to engage students with this traditional craft. By participating in hands-on batik-making workshops, students can learn about the meticulous process of wax-resist dyeing, which not only fosters creativity but also enhances their appreciation for patience and craftsmanship. Furthermore, studying the history and cultural significance of batik patterns can deepen students' understanding of Indonesian heritage, promoting a sense of pride and identity.

Batik Workshops and Interactive Sessions

Organizing interactive batik workshops and sessions in community centers and cultural festivals can provide practical exposure to the art. These workshops, guided by skilled artisans, allow young individuals to experience the batik process firsthand, from sketching designs to the final dyeing stage. Such immersive experiences are instrumental in making the art form more relatable and interesting, thereby increasing its appeal among the youth.

Digital Platforms and Social Media Engagement

In today's digital age, social media platforms are powerful tools for education and engagement. Creating online tutorials, interactive batik design contests, and showcasing the work of young batik artists can attract a broader audience. Platforms like Instagram, YouTube, and Pinterest are ideal for sharing vibrant batik patterns and stories behind them, making the art form accessible to a global audience and encouraging young people to try their hand at batik.

Collaborations with Fashion Industry

The fashion industry plays a crucial role in popularizing traditional crafts. By collaborating with fashion designers to incorporate batik patterns into contemporary clothing, the art of batik can be revitalized and made appealing to the younger generation. Limited edition batik collections, fashion shows, and celebrity endorsements can help in positioning batik as a trendy and desirable art form.

The journey of batik from a traditional craft to a celebrated art form among the youth involves education, interaction, and modernization. By embedding batik in educational curriculums, facilitating hands-on workshops, leveraging digital platforms, and collaborating with the fashion industry, there is a significant opportunity to enhance the appreciation of this exquisite art form. Through these efforts, batik can transcend its traditional boundaries, captivating and inspiring the young minds of today and tomorrow.
